Bug reports: create "logs" folder and populate it at each run (#500)
* Bug reports: create "logs" folder and populate it at each run

This makes it easier for people to open issues
as we will ask them to attach every file in the "logs" folder.

File have the .txt extension so they can easily be
drag & dropped into gihub issues

For Arch people: to obtain the shell-output.log, we will ask them to do it
by hand:

makepkg [args] | tee shell-output.log

Signed-off-by: Adel KARA SLIMANE <adel.ks@zegrapher.com>

* prepare: cleanup "logs" folder at each run

So some files, that usually get appended to, don't
grow to infinity.

This behavior needs to be changed if we decide to
keep more logs than the latest one.

#!/bin/bash
# If current run is not using 'script' for logging, do it
if [ -z "$SCRIPT" ]; then
export SCRIPT=1
/usr/bin/script -q -e -c "$0 $@" shell-output.log
exit_status="$?"
sed -i 's/\x1b\[[0-9;]*m//g' shell-output.log
sed -i 's/\x1b(B//g' shell-output.log
mv -f shell-output.log logs/shell-output.log.txt
exit $exit_status
fi
# Stop the script at any ecountered error
set -e
_where=`pwd`
srcdir="$_where"
source customization.cfg
source linux-tkg-config/prepare
msg2() {
echo -e " \033[1;34m->\033[1;0m \033[1;1m$1\033[1;0m" >&2
}
error() {
echo -e " \033[1;31m==> ERROR: $1\033[1;0m" >&2
}
warning() {
echo -e " \033[1;33m==> WARNING: $1\033[1;0m" >&2
}
plain() {
echo -e "$1" >&2
}
_distro_prompt() {
echo "Which linux distribution are you running ?"
echo "if it's not on the list, chose the closest one to it: Fedora/Suse for RPM, Ubuntu/Debian for DEB"
_prompt_from_array "Debian" "Fedora" "Suse" "Ubuntu" "Gentoo" "Generic"
_distro="${_selected_value}"
}
_install_dependencies() {
if [ "$_compiler_name" = "llvm" ]; then
clang_deps="llvm clang lld"
fi
if [ "$_distro" = "Debian" -o "$_distro" = "Ubuntu" ]; then
msg2 "Installing dependencies"
sudo apt install bc bison build-essential ccache cpio fakeroot flex git kmod libelf-dev libncurses5-dev libssl-dev lz4 qtbase5-dev rsync schedtool wget zstd ${clang_deps} -y
elif [ "$_distro" = "Fedora" ]; then
msg2 "Installing dependencies"
if [ $(rpm -E %fedora) = "32" ]; then
sudo dnf install bison ccache dwarves elfutils-libelf-devel fedora-packager fedpkg flex gcc-c++ git grubby libXi-devel lz4 ncurses-devel openssl-devel pesign qt5-devel rpm-build rpmdevtools schedtool zstd ${clang_deps} -y
else
sudo dnf install bison ccache dwarves elfutils-devel elfutils-libelf-devel fedora-packager fedpkg flex gcc-c++ git grubby libXi-devel lz4 make ncurses-devel openssl openssl-devel perl-devel perl-generators pesign python3-devel qt5-qtbase-devel rpm-build rpmdevtools schedtool zstd -y ${clang_deps} -y
fi
elif [ "$_distro" = "Suse" ]; then
msg2 "Installing dependencies"
sudo zypper install -y bc bison ccache dwarves elfutils flex gcc-c++ git libXi-devel libelf-devel libqt5-qtbase-common-devel libqt5-qtbase-devel lz4 make ncurses-devel openssl-devel patch pesign rpm-build rpmdevtools schedtool ${clang_deps}
fi
}
_linux_git_branch_checkout() {
cd "$_where"
if [[ -z "$_git_mirror" || ! "$_git_mirror" =~ ^(kernel\.org|googlesource\.com)$ ]]; then
while true; do
echo "Which git repository would you like to clone the linux sources from ?"
echo " 0) kernel.org (official)"
echo " 1) googlesource.com (faster mirror)"
read -p "[0-1]: " _git_repo_index
if [ "$_git_repo_index" = "0" ]; then
_git_mirror="kernel.org"
break
elif [ "$_git_repo_index" = "1" ]; then
_git_mirror="googlesource.com"
break
else
echo "Wrong index."
fi
done
fi
if ! [ -d linux-src-git ]; then
msg2 "First initialization of the linux source code git folder"
mkdir linux-src-git
cd linux-src-git
git init
git remote add kernel.org https://git.kernel.org/pub/scm/linux/kernel/git/stable/linux.git
git remote add googlesource.com https://kernel.googlesource.com/pub/scm/linux/kernel/git/stable/linux-stable
else
cd linux-src-git
# Remove "origin" remote if present
if git remote -v | grep -w "origin" ; then
git remote rm origin
fi
if ! git remote -v | grep -w "kernel.org" ; then
git remote add kernel.org https://git.kernel.org/pub/scm/linux/kernel/git/stable/linux.git
fi
if ! git remote -v | grep -w "googlesource.com" ; then
git remote add googlesource.com https://kernel.googlesource.com/pub/scm/linux/kernel/git/stable/linux-stable
fi
msg2 "Current branch: $(git branch | grep "\*")"
msg2 "Reseting files to their original state"
git reset --hard HEAD
git clean -f -d -x
fi
if [[ "$_sub" = rc* ]]; then
msg2 "Switching to master branch for RC Kernel"
if ! git branch --list | grep "master-${_git_mirror}" ; then
msg2 "master branch doesn't locally exist, shallow cloning..."
git remote set-branches --add kernel.org master
git remote set-branches --add googlesource.com master
git fetch --depth=1 $_git_mirror master
git fetch --depth 1 $_git_mirror tag "v${_basekernel}-${_sub}"
git checkout -b master-${_git_mirror} ${_git_mirror}/master
else
msg2 "master branch exists locally, updating..."
git checkout master-${_git_mirror}
git fetch --depth 1 $_git_mirror tag "v${_basekernel}-${_sub}"
git reset --hard ${_git_mirror}/master
fi
msg2 "Checking out latest RC tag: v${_basekernel}-${_sub}"
git checkout "v${_basekernel}-${_sub}"
else
# define kernel tag so we treat the 0 subver properly
_kernel_tag="v${_basekernel}.${_sub}"
if [ "$_sub" = "0" ];then
_kernel_tag="v${_basekernel}"
fi
msg2 "Switching to linux-${_basekernel}.y"
if ! git branch --list | grep -w "linux-${_basekernel}-${_git_mirror}" ; then
msg2 "${_basekernel}.y branch doesn't locally exist, shallow cloning..."
git remote set-branches --add kernel.org linux-${_basekernel}.y
git remote set-branches --add googlesource.com linux-${_basekernel}.y
git fetch --depth=1 $_git_mirror linux-${_basekernel}.y
git fetch --depth=1 $_git_mirror tag "${_kernel_tag}"
git checkout -b linux-${_basekernel}-${_git_mirror} ${_git_mirror}/linux-${_basekernel}.y
else
msg2 "${_basekernel}.y branch exists locally, updating..."
git checkout linux-${_basekernel}-${_git_mirror}
git fetch --depth 1 $_git_mirror tag "${_kernel_tag}"
git reset --hard ${_git_mirror}/linux-${_basekernel}.y
fi
msg2 "Checking out latest release: ${_kernel_tag}"
git checkout "${_kernel_tag}"
fi
}
if [ "$1" != "install" ] && [ "$1" != "config" ] && [ "$1" != "uninstall-help" ]; then
msg2 "Argument not recognised, options are:
- config : interactive script that shallow clones the linux 5.x.y git tree into the folder linux-src-git, then applies extra patches and prepares the .config file
by copying the one from the currently running linux system and updates it.
- install : does the config step, proceeds to compile, then prompts to install
- 'DEB' distros: it creates .deb packages that will be installed then stored in the DEBS folder.
- 'RPM' distros: it creates .rpm packages that will be installed then stored in the RPMS folder.
- 'Generic' distro: it uses 'make modules_install' and 'make install', uses 'dracut' to create an initramfs, then updates grub's boot entry.
- uninstall-help : [RPM and DEB based distros only], lists the installed kernels in this system, then gives hints on how to uninstall them manually."
exit 0
fi

elif [[ "$_distro" =~ ^(Gentoo|Generic)$ ]]; then
./scripts/config --set-str LOCALVERSION "-${_kernel_flavor}"
if [[ "$_sub" = rc* ]]; then
_kernelname=$_basekernel.${_kernel_subver}-${_sub}-$_kernel_flavor
else
_kernelname=$_basekernel.${_kernel_subver}-$_kernel_flavor
fi
msg2 "Building kernel"
_timed_build make ${llvm_opt} -j ${_thread_num}
msg2 "Build successful"
if [ "$_STRIP" = "true" ]; then
echo "Stripping vmlinux..."
strip -v $STRIP_STATIC "vmlinux"
fi
_headers_folder_name="linux-$_kernelname"
msg2 "Removing unneeded architectures..."
for arch in arch/*/; do
[[ $arch = */x86/ ]] && continue
echo "Removing $(basename "$arch")"
rm -r "$arch"
done
msg2 "Removing broken symlinks..."
find -L . -type l -printf 'Removing %P\n' -delete
msg2 "Removing loose objects..."
find . -type f -name '*.o' -printf 'Removing %P\n' -delete
msg2 "Stripping build tools..."
while read -rd '' file; do
case "$(file -bi "$file")" in
application/x-sharedlib\;*) # Libraries (.so)
strip -v $STRIP_SHARED "$file" ;;
application/x-archive\;*) # Libraries (.a)
strip -v $STRIP_STATIC "$file" ;;
application/x-executable\;*) # Binaries
strip -v $STRIP_BINARIES "$file" ;;
application/x-pie-executable\;*) # Relocatable binaries
strip -v $STRIP_SHARED "$file" ;;
esac
done < <(find . -type f -perm -u+x ! -name vmlinux -print0)
echo -e "\n\n"
msg2 "The installation process will run the following commands:"
echo " # copy the patched and compiled sources to /usr/src/$_headers_folder_name"
echo " sudo make modules_install"
echo " sudo make install"
echo " sudo dracut --force --hostonly ${_dracut_options} --kver $_kernelname"
echo " sudo grub-mkconfig -o /boot/grub/grub.cfg"
msg2 "Note: Uninstalling requires manual intervention, use './install.sh uninstall-help' for more information."
read -p "Continue ? Y/[n]: " _continue
if ! [[ "$_continue" =~ ^(Y|y|Yes|yes)$ ]];then
exit 0
fi
msg2 "Copying files over to /usr/src/$_headers_folder_name"
if [ -d "/usr/src/$_headers_folder_name" ]; then
msg2 "Removing old folder in /usr/src/$_headers_folder_name"
sudo rm -rf "/usr/src/$_headers_folder_name"
fi
sudo cp -R . "/usr/src/$_headers_folder_name"
sudo rm -rf "/usr/src/$_headers_folder_name/.git"
cd "/usr/src/$_headers_folder_name"
msg2 "Installing modules"
if [ "$_STRIP" = "true" ]; then
sudo make modules_install INSTALL_MOD_STRIP="1"
else
sudo make modules_install
fi
msg2 "Removing modules from source folder in /usr/src/${_kernel_src_gentoo}"
sudo find . -type f -name '*.ko' -delete
sudo find . -type f -name '*.ko.cmd' -delete
msg2 "Installing kernel"
sudo make install
msg2 "Creating initramfs"
sudo dracut --force --hostonly ${_dracut_options} --kver $_kernelname
msg2 "Updating GRUB"
sudo grub-mkconfig -o /boot/grub/grub.cfg
if [ "$_distro" = "Gentoo" ]; then
msg2 "Selecting the kernel source code as default source folder"
sudo ln -sfn "/usr/src/$_headers_folder_name" "/usr/src/linux"
msg2 "Rebuild kernel modules with \"emerge @module-rebuild\" ?"
if [ "$_compiler" = "llvm" ];then
warning "Building modules with LLVM/Clang is mostly unsupported OOTB by \"emerge @module-rebuild\" except for Nvidia 465.31+"
warning " Manually setting \"CC=clang\" for some modules may work if you haven't used LTO"
fi
read -p "Y/[n]: " _continue
if [[ "$_continue" =~ ^(Y|y|Yes|yes)$ ]];then
sudo emerge @module-rebuild --keep-going
fi
fi
fi
fi
if [ "$1" = "uninstall-help" ]; then
if [ -z $_distro ]; then
_distro_prompt
fi
cd "$_where"
if [[ "$_distro" =~ ^(Ubuntu|Debian)$ ]]; then
msg2 "List of installed custom tkg kernels: "
dpkg -l "*tkg*" | grep "linux.*tkg"
dpkg -l "*linux-libc-dev*" | grep "linux.*tkg"
msg2 "To uninstall a version, you should remove the linux-image, linux-headers and linux-libc-dev associated to it (if installed), with: "
msg2 " sudo apt remove linux-image-VERSION linux-headers-VERSION linux-libc-dev-VERSION"
msg2 " where VERSION is displayed in the lists above, uninstall only versions that have \"tkg\" in its name"
msg2 "Note: linux-libc-dev packages are no longer created and installed, you can safely remove any remnants."
elif [ "$_distro" = "Fedora" ]; then
msg2 "List of installed custom tkg kernels: "
dnf list --installed kernel*
msg2 "To uninstall a version, you should remove the kernel, kernel-headers and kernel-devel associated to it (if installed), with: "
msg2 " sudo dnf remove --noautoremove kernel-VERSION kernel-devel-VERSION kernel-headers-VERSION"
msg2 " where VERSION is displayed in the second column"
msg2 "Note: kernel-headers packages are no longer created and installed, you can safely remove any remnants."
elif [ "$_distro" = "Suse" ]; then
msg2 "List of installed custom tkg kernels: "
zypper packages --installed-only | grep "kernel.*tkg"
msg2 "To uninstall a version, you should remove the kernel, kernel-headers and kernel-devel associated to it (if installed), with: "
msg2 " sudo zypper remove --no-clean-deps kernel-VERSION kernel-devel-VERSION kernel-headers-VERSION"
msg2 " where VERSION is displayed in the second to last column"
msg2 "Note: kernel-headers packages are no longer created and installed, you can safely remove any remnants."
elif [[ "$_distro" =~ ^(Generic|Gentoo)$ ]]; then
msg2 "Folders in /lib/modules :"
ls /lib/modules
msg2 "Files in /boot :"
ls /boot
msg2 "To uninstall a kernel version installed through install.sh with 'Generic' as a distro:"
msg2 " - Remove manually the corresponding folder in '/lib/modules'"
msg2 " - Remove manually the corresponding 'System.map', 'vmlinuz', 'config' and 'initramfs' in the folder :/boot"
msg2 " - Update the boot menu. e.g. 'sudo grub-mkconfig -o /boot/grub/grub.cfg'"
fi
fi
